Kelly W. Thye

Kelly W. Thye joined The Moore Law Firm in November 2018. He has been practicing law in Cincinnati since 2002.

Kelly grew up outside a small town in rural Iowa. In his youth, he was exposed to a variety of farming and agricultural occupations and his first job was with Cargill seed company detasseling. This continued every summer for over a decade and with other companies such as Pioneer and McAllister Seed Co., Inc. It even broadened into other seasonal tasks of roguing and volunteer corn. He used what he earned each summer to fuel his hobby of reading and traveling.

Once he graduated high school, he continued to The University of Iowa where he earned a degree majoring in History and Political Science. It was there that he really appreciated the wealth of literature contained at the university and eventually focused on the historical significance of World War II, Vichy propaganda, political philosophy, and the law.

He continued his education and received his Juris Doctor from the Capital University School of Law. He was interested in the social contract and his law review article focused on moral right.

It was when he travelled to London and saw the Magna Carta that his interest in historical conflict and the law took shape. He was now driven to assist the unfortunate and aggrieved.

With a foundation based in rural Iowa and an education steeped in conflict and law, he is no stranger to hard work and complex problems. Throughout his career, Kelly has applied determination, creativity, compassion, and patience to his practice.

Kelly is now married and a father of two. He continues to be an active reader when family and work obligations permit. His interest in historical conflict has broadened to a variety of complex wargames and other strategical games, both tabletop and card driven.

Education and Bar
Admissions

Kelly attended the University of Iowa and graduated with honors with a degree in History and Political Science. He continued his education and received his Juris Doctor from the Capital University School of Law.

Following his law school graduation, Kelly continued his commitment to helping the injured when he worked for firms in Columbus, OH and Cincinnati, OH before joining The Moore Law Firm in 2018.

Kelly is admitted to practice before all state courts in Ohio and the U.S. Federal District Courts in the Southern District of Ohio.
